Planning and Managing SharePoint 2016 Productivity Solutions
When implementing SharePoint 2016 you need to understand core SharePoint and how to create beneficial solutions. As an Administrator, you need to understand app management, configuration of productivity services, and additional application features.
What you'll learn
As a SharePoint Administrator, you are tasked with ensuring productivity solutions are available within the organization. There are many services and components that should be enabled, deployed, and configured to support this. Knowing which ones to use, and how to deploy them is just one element of this process. In this course, Planning and Managing SharePoint 2016 Productivity Solutions, you will learn foundational knowledge of/gain the ability to create and configure features that ensure SharePoint is an effective and resourceful tool in your organization. First, you will learn how to configure and implement service applications to provide productivity solutions. Next, you will discover how configuring Hybrid to Office 365 can benefit both you as a SharePoint Administrator and your end users. Finally, you will explore how to manage solutions within SharePoint, whether custom developed or purchased from the Microsoft Store. When you’re finished with this course, you will have the skills and knowledge of SharePoint 2016 Productivity Solutions needed to configure, implement, and manage SharePoint 2016 Productivity Solutions.
